Shopping for stocks at PDAC
With junior miners struggling for financing, many market watchers have concluded that it’s a buyer’s market — but only if investors can distinguish the quality companies from the ones that won’t last another year or two.

The S&P/TSX Venture Composite Index lost 1.7%, or 20.16 points, en route to a 1,185.65-point close. Canadian stocks were weighed down by falling commodity prices, and further economic uncertainty in Europe.
